State Dept. confirms kidnapping of American couple in Haiti

At a press briefing Thursday, the State Department confirmed the kidnapping of two U.S. citizens in Haiti. “We are in regular contact with Haitian authorities and will continue to work with them and our US government interagency partners, but I don't have any other specific updates to offer at this time,” said State Department Deputy Spokesman Vedant Patel. Florida couple Jean-Dickens Toussaint and Abigail Michael Toussaint were abducted on March 18 around Port-au-Prince and are being held under ransom demands.
